Contrast

#b9fa47 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
1.25:1failfailfail
  • AA: use #538103 as the text (4.66:1)
  • AAA: use #3d5e02 as the text (7.5: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#666666 (4.6:1)
  • AAA: or shift the background to #4a4a4a (7.1:1)
Aaon black
16.83:1passpasspassPasses AAA — no fix needed.

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#b9fa47 as the background.
